Old Testament Hero #4: Daniel

Carried away from the land of Israel while still a boy, Daniel lived as a Jew in exile under the Babylonian empire. Groomed to be an advisor in King Nebuchadnezzar’s court, even as a boy, Daniel and his friends rejected the food of the king to keep the Law of Moses, a commitment he would keep into adulthood, eventually landing him in a pit of lions for refusing to call the king a god. Interpreting dreams and visions, Daniel would be a service to all kingdoms, and beheld the promise of God’s coming rule. The prophet Ezekiel describes him as a “pattern of righteousness.”

Bible story: Daniel 1-12

Old Testament Hero #5: Esther

The book named for her is the only one in all of Scripture that never mentions the name of God, yet in Esther’s life the Lord’s will and hand are ever-visible. Born in exile, the orphaned Esther was raised by her cousin Mordecai. Chosen by the king for her beauty to be a faithful queen, Esther was raised out of the low position of the Jews in Persia to one of prominence. In this position, Esther remained a faithful woman of God, fasting and praying while still maintaining devotion and submission to her king husband. It was her courage and dignity that saved the Jews of Persia from genocide, a deliverance still celebrated among Jewish communities to this day as Purim.

Bible story: Esther 1-10
